Look: Springtime Pink & Green

I need new color combination ideas. I can’t wait for MAC Graphic Garden because those will be fun colors to put together. I was thinking about pairing up pink and green for this look. Not bright like the Barbie look; just soft colors, but that aren’t overly blended and muddy. I couldn’t think of regular e/s colors that I wanted to use for this look, so I went with all pigments.

For this look I used:

  • Eyes: UDPPS (primer), Fresco Rose PP (base), Apricot Pink Pigment (all over lid up to crease), Golder’s Green Pigment (crease & above crease), Antique Green Pigment (crease), Pink Opal Pigment (highlight), Bobbi Brown Ivy Shimmer Ink (upper lashline), Jealous Kohl Power (waterline), Chanel Exceptionnel mascara
  • Cheeks: Laura Geller Pink Grapefruit mineralized blush + Bobbi Brown Pink Platinum Shimmer Brick
  • Lips: Guerlain Candy Shine l/s + YSL Golden Gloss #10
